Individual sounds are first taught to children. Once students can pick out individual sounds demonstrate blending the sounds together to hear full words.

Give students a few practice words m-u-g mug s-i-t sit etc. Then theyll usually proceed to blending these sounds. Starts by saying the word slowly.

You say h a t and a child says hat Blending can also refer to a students ability to say each sound in a written word and blend the sounds together. This procedure is known as sound blending. Then says it a bit faster gradually blending the sounds.

Be sure to lengthen make longer the consonant sound you are blending. Read more about the importance of phonemic awareness here. Some children master this skill easily while others might need some extra help and practice.

Guided practice The instructor provides scaffolding support or prompting to help the learner blend sounds successfully. There are five main activity types to practice in Kindergarten- rhyming and alliteration phoneme categorization oral blending oral segmentation and phoneme substitution.
